I ordered my shawarma with all the toppings. I got chicken and what I think we're pickle strips. No sauces, no lettuce/cabbage, no cheese, no tomatoes, no cucumbers, no peppers. The only explanation I can think of is that there may have been a language barrier issue. I usually get shawarma from Reading terminal market in Philly, and if those are the metric by which others are measured, then this one was a distant 2nd. It was still very tasty, and definitely worth it, but I cannot give it 5 stars. The salad was pretty good, and a very good size, if somewhat heavy on the parsley.
As it is a stand, there is only outdoor seating, and just a few small tables, right at the corner of a somewhat busy intersection, so grabbing food to go is likely to make for a more pleasant place to sit. There is a little bit of seating in a small garden area just a few steps away, which looked quite nice.

Omar’s Halal Grill is a decent place if you’re looking for a quick halal meal, but overall my experience was just okay. The menu has a good variety, and the portion sizes are generous, which is definitely a plus. The food was flavorful enough, though I felt it could use a bit more seasoning and freshness to really stand out.

Service was polite, but the wait was longer than expected given the small crowd. The restaurant itself is casual, with limited ambiance—it works fine for a quick bite but doesn’t feel like a place to sit and enjoy a relaxed meal. Pricing is fair for the amount of food you get, though not particularly memorable compared to other halal spots in the area.

Overall, Omar’s Halal Grill gets the job done, but it didn’t leave a strong impression. A good option if you’re nearby and hungry, but not necessarily worth going out of your way for.
